Fuel Cell System Applications -Electric Scooter
 


ZES III (Zero Emission Scooter 3rd generation) - European Model

The APFCT 3rd generation scooter ZES III was begun in December 2001 and completed in July 2002. ZES III is a totally new integrated fuel cell/chassis scooter designed from grounds-up. Its modern European styling compliments its advanced fuel cell engine technology. Performance of ZES III was tested at 58 kph speed and 120 km driving range using 4 MH hydrogen storage canisters. ZES III was Exhibited at 2002 Intermot Muenchen (3rd International Trade Fair for Motorcycles and Scooters) in Munich, Germany; the 2002 Fuel Cell Seminar Conference at Palm Springs, CA, USA; and the 2003 Hanover Fair in Hannover, Germany
 

Specifications of APFCT ZES III:

Dimensions (LxWxH)
2083x 812x1321(mm)
Weight
143kg
Front Wheel
120/70-12”
Rear Wheel
130/70-12”
Maxi Speed
58km/hr
Climbing
20km/hr@8degree
Driving Range
120km@30km/hr
80km@urban mode
Fuel Consumption @ 30km/hr
1.6 gram hydrogen/km
Motor Type
DC Brushless Motor
Transmission
CVT
Nominal Voltage
48 volts
Maximum Current
70 amps
Fuel Type
Pure Hydrogen
Fuel Storage
Metal Hydride
Refuel
Canister Swap
Refuel Time
3min
Noise
78dB
